A Cleveland staple of kielbasa, French fries, barbecue sauce, and slaw stuffed in a bun. It reflects the city's Eastern European and blue-collar food traditions.
Hearty Slovak-style stuffed cabbage rolls baked in tomato sauce. They are traditional in many Cleveland immigrant families and church festival menus.
Crisp potato pancakes often served with applesauce or sour cream. They are closely tied to Cleveland's strong Central and Eastern European heritage.

Moderate for U.S. city travel: hotels and dining are usually cheaper than New York or Chicago, while transit and attractions are generally manageable for visitors.
Tip 18-20% at restaurants, 15-20% for taxis, and $1-2 per drink or coffee in cafes if service is good.
